COLLEGE PARK, Md. – The Maryland Clean Energy Center (MCEC) announced a historic appointment to its Board of Directors: Dr. Karen Wayland, CEO of Gridwise Alliance. She has been named the first female Chair in the organization’s history.
As Chair of the Board of Directors, Dr. Wayland will provide crucial leadership in shaping strategic goals of MCEC, reviewing policies, and cultivating key relationships essential for driving progress in the clean energy landscape. Her extensive background includes years of impactful work with the U.S. Department of Energy and with elected officials on Capitol Hill. Currently, as CEO of Gridwise Alliance, Dr. Wayland leads a diverse membership of electricity industry stakeholders dedicated to accelerating innovation that delivers a more secure, reliable, resilient, and affordable grid, all while supporting the decarbonization of the U.S. economy.
